                                Originally posted by paulrkytek

                                Do you mean the 12 blade out-runner into the Avanti with the 9 blade in-runner, if so I would think not as it would be a retrograde step?
                                Yes your right I found out you have to exchange the whole fan unit not just the blade which was what I wanted to do. But you can put the inrunner motor in the 12 blade fan unit.

                                  Just got my Red ARF+. What’s the best way to fix the overlapping nose gear doors?

                                    I’m in the minority, on mine I pulled them off and took a heat gut and warped them slightly bowed out. Most glue a carbon rod along the lip.
